A Donation Agreement, also sometimes called a Charitable Gift Agreement, provides written proof for a donation, or gift, that has been given to a charitable organization in the United States.
A donation agreement will include the names of the parties, a description of the donation, whether a receipt that was given, and possibly the intended use for the donation. The agreement should also include a revocability (whether the donation can be taken back) section and define expense responsibility.
A consulting contract should offer a detailed description of the duties you will perform and the deliverables you promise the client. The agreement may also explain how much work you will perform at the client's office and how often you will work remotely.
